Another Scenic Stamp

The stamped image does most of the heavy lifting here. But I was inspired to create bg from THIS video. Following the video, I brayed from my ink pad a red/orange on half of the gel plate then and purple on the other half, splattered with water then pulled print onto white cs. Stamped image in light gray and then water colored. Sponged purple ink from pad along horizon and along edges then re-stamped in black ink. Added snow with gel pen and white ink with a brush to hills, trees and structures. Added snow splatter with white ink and splatter brush. To flatted the much loved cs plus add texture I ran it through a linen look embossing folder. Mounted on white cs base. Added a few details like the tree trunks and tree boughs with colored markers.
